Readability and Cutting Machine Performance
If you work with digital files for cutting machines, you know that not all fonts are created equal. Some intricate details get lost when scaled down, while others look blurry when printed on glossy paper. Shooby Doobie maintains its character well across different mediums. The open counters (the enclosed spaces inside letters like 'e' or 'a') prevent ink bleed on porous materials like cardboard or fabric.
For SVG-style designs, the vector paths are typically clean, making them easy to edit in software like Illustrator or Inkscape. However, always test your file before mass production. Try printing a mockup on the actual material you plan to use. If you are creating printable wall art, ensure the resolution is high enough so the serifs don't look jagged. Because it is a serif font, it naturally guides the eye along lines of text, which helps with longer descriptions on packaging or recipe cards included with your products.

Smart Font Pairing Strategies
To maximize the impact of Shooby Doobie, consider how it interacts with other design assets. Since it has a strong personality, it should generally be the star of the show. Here are a few pairing ideas:
- With a Clean Sans-Serif: Pair Shooby Doobie with a minimalist sans-serif font for subtitles or long descriptions. The contrast between the bouncy serif and the straight lines creates a modern, balanced look. This is great for price tags or ingredient lists.
- With a Script Font: For a truly romantic or artistic feel, combine it with a flowing script font or handwritten font. Use Shooby Doobie for the main title and the script for accents or dates. This combination works wonderfully for wedding invitations and greeting cards.
- Monochromatic Designs: Stick to one color palette but vary the weight. Use a bold version of the font for emphasis and a lighter version for secondary information. This keeps the design cohesive without looking flat.
Licensing and Commercial Use
As a creator, protecting your business means understanding the legal side of the tools you use. Before downloading any modern typography, check the license agreement carefully. Most premium fonts offer specific licenses for commercial use, which allow you to sell physical products like mugs, shirts, and stickers. However, there may be restrictions on digital downloads, such as including the font file itself in a zip file for resale.
Ensure your license covers the specific activities you perform, whether that is creating SVG files for clients, producing printables, or manufacturing merchandise. A valid commercial license gives you peace of mind and protects you from potential legal issues.
